Understanding Over-the-Counter MedicationsWhat are OTC Medications?
Over the counter medications are pharmaceuticals that can be purchased without a prescription from a healthcare provider. These medications are generally considered safe and reliable for public usage when consumers follow the directions on the packaging and utilize them for the shown functions.
Typical Categories of OTC Medications
OTC medications usually fall under several classifications, each designated for specific kinds of disorders. Here's a breakdown of typical categories:
CategoryExamplesUtilizesAnalgesicsAcetaminophen, IbuprofenPain relief, minimizing feverAntihistaminesDiphenhydramine, LoratadineAllergic reaction relief, cold symptomsAntacidsCalcium carbonate, RanitidineHeartburn, indigestionLaxativesPsyllium, BisacodylIrregularity reliefCough and ColdDextromethorphan, GuaifenesinCough suppression, mucus reductionTopical treatmentsHydrocortisone, BacitracinSkin inflammation, minor cuts, and burnsSleep helpMelatonin, DiphenhydramineSleeping disorders reliefValue of Understanding OTC Medications
While OTC medications are extensively offered, consumers ought to remain informed about their uses, does, and possible side impacts. Misuse or overuse of these medications can lead to unfavorable reactions and health problems.

Risks and Considerations
Despite the fact that OTC medications offer convenience, they likewise carry threats if misused. Here are some essential factors to consider:
Potential Risks of OTC Medication Use
Drug Interactions: Some OTC medications can communicate with recommended drugs, possibly reducing their efficiency or increasing the danger of adverse effects.

Overdosing: Consumers may unintentionally take more than the recommended dosage, resulting in severe health dangers, particularly with painkiller and cold medications.

Misdiagnosis: Relying entirely on OTC medications may lead to postponed or missed diagnosis of more severe health concerns.

Allergies: Some people might experience allergies to certain parts of OTC medications.
Guidelines for Safe Use
To ensure safe usage of OTC medications, consumers need to comply with the following guidelines:

Read Labels Carefully: Always follow the maker's guidelines and guidelines provided on the packaging.

Examine Expiry Dates: Ensure medications are within their expiration dates to avoid decreased efficacy.

Consult Healthcare Professionals: Before beginning any OTC medication, specifically for people with persistent conditions, it's recommended to speak with a doctor.

Keep a Medication Log: Maintain a record of all medications being taken, including OTC drugs, to monitor potential interactions and does.
